Pro Eintrag werden folgende Informationen angezeigt:
● Rang
Die Speicherobjekte werden nach ihrem Speicherverbrauch angeordnet.
● Gebundener (allokierter) Speicher und gebundener (benutzter) Speicher
Gebundener Speicher wird beim vollständigen Löschen (bei internen Tabellen mit FREE) frei. Zum gebundenen Speicher eines Objekts gehört auch der Speicher, der von Objekten verbraucht wird, die nur als Referenzen auf das betreffende Objekt vorhanden sind. Enthält z.B. eine interne Tabelle exklusiv Referenzen auf Datenobjekte, die vom Garbage Collector nach dem Löschen der Tabelle freigegeben werden können, tragen die referenzierten Objekte mit zum gebundenen Speicher bei.
● Referenzierter (allokierter) Speicher und referenzierter (benutzter) Speicher
Hier handelt es sich um den Speicher, auf den das Datenobjekt verweist (eventuell über andere Datenobjekte hinweg). Dieser Speicher wird beim Löschen des Datenobjekts nicht freigegeben, wenn noch andere Datenobjekte auf den Speicher verweisen. Der referenzierte Speicher ist immer größer oder gleich dem gebundenen Speicher.
● SZK- (allokierter) Speicher und SZK- (benutzter) Speicher
Eine starke Zusammenhangskomponente zeichnet sich dadurch aus, dass für je zwei Elemente A und B ein Pfad im Objektgraph von A nach B als auch von B nach A existiert. Daher können die Elemente einer starken Zusammenhangskomponente nur vom Garbage Collector gelöscht werden, vorausgesetzt, dass alle Referenzen von außen auf Elemente der Komponente gelöscht wurden. Starke Zusammenhangskomponenten können als zusammengesetzte Objekte betrachtet werden, die nur im Ganzen gelöscht werden können.
Im Vergleich zur Rangliste enthält die Typen-Rangliste noch die Spalte Zeilen / Instanzen mit der Anzahl der Tabellenzeilen bzw. der Anzahl der Klasseninstanzen.
Für jede Tabelle werden folgende Informationen angezeigt:
● Zeilen (allokiert), Zeilen (benutzt) undBelegung - Zeilen (%)
Die Spalten geben die allokierten und benutzten Zeilen sowie die Belegung in Prozent an.
● Gebundener (allokierter) Speicher und gebundener (benutzter) Speicher
● Referenzierter (allokierter) Speicher und referenzierter (benutzter) Speicher
● Spaltenbreite
● RefCount
Diese Spalte enthält die Anzahl der Referenzen auf die Tabelle.
Für jede Klasse werden folgende Informationen angezeigt:
● Rang
● Anzahl Instanzen
● Gebundener (allokierter) Speicher und gebundener (benutzter) Speicher
● Referenzierter (allokierter) Speicher und referenzierter (benutzter) Speicher
● Klassenattribute
● Instanzgröße
Für jedes Programm werden folgende Informationen angezeigt:
● Rang
● Globale Daten
● Anzahl Instanzen
● Anzahl Tabellen
● Anzahl Strings
● Anzahl Datenobjekte
Für jeden Service werden folgende Informationen angezeigt:
● Rang
● Größe
Speicherverbrauch des Service
Für jeden Parameter werden folgende Informationen angezeigt:
● Rang
● Gesamtgröße
● Anzahl
Anzahl der Parameter
Für jeden Objektzyklus werden folgende Informationen angezeigt:
● Rang
● Anzahl Speicherobjekte
Anzahl der Objekte pro Zyklus
● Gebundener (allokierter) Speicher und gebundener (benutzter) Speicher
● Referenzierter (allokierter) Speicher und referenzierter (benutzter) Speicher